About This Item
Punch, 1873. Hardcover. Good/No Jacket. A complete bound set of editions of "Punch" from 30th December 1871 to April 19th, 1873. At some stage the collection has been rebound. Original spine titling affixed. The frontispage has a most interesting ex-libris plate from the revered military historian, Dr Felix Machanik. The boards are scuffed, marked and worn all about. They are balefully benign. Within, aside from marks and wear to the frontispages, and with some foxing here and there, the contents are pleasurable.
